解雇nsviewcontroller迅速不起作用

问题描述 投票:5回答:4

这是按钮操作:

    @IBAction func readyPressed(sender: NSButton) {

    self.dismissController(Hardness)
    println(1)
    self.performSegueWithIdentifier("manual", sender: self)
    }

当我按下按钮,作品的println,赛格瑞作品,但NSViewController“硬度”不关闭

xcode macos swift nsviewcontroller
4个回答
-8
投票

请尝试使用

self.dismissViewControllerAnimated(真,完成:{});

或使用

navigationController.popViewControllerAnimated(真)

这里所提出

how to dismiss a view controller in swift


21
投票

试试这条线关闭窗口:self.view.window?.close()


2
投票

你必须从按钮添加行动急救员 - dismissController:


0
投票

你可以试试

NSViewController()。解雇(VC)。

被驳回的ViewController应该作为参数传递和调用者可以是任何NSViewController对象。

© www.soinside.com 2019 - 2024. All rights reserved.